Formation of Several-Micrometer-Thick Polycrystalline Silicon Films on Soda Lime Glass by Flash Lamp Annealing [PDF]
We have succeeded in forming polycrystalline silicon (poly-Si) films with thicknesses of over 4 μm on soda lime glass by flash lamp annealing (FLA) of precursor amorphous Si (a-Si) films deposited by catalytic chemical vapor deposition (Cat-CVD).

Structural and Functional Siderophore Remodeling by Enzymatic Delipidation
A surprising functional switch in bacterial siderophores was discovered through genome mining and the analysis of environmental and pathogenic Pandoraea species.
